Abstract:
During the performance of Oil and Gas contracts, which are usually one of the longest investment contracts, there may be incidents in which the relations between the parties and the fulfillment of obligations, change and become unstable. In order to deal with the new situation, which may prevent the fulfillment of the obligation or make its performance difficult, various theories have been expressed, which we have examined under the heading of contractual excuses. Contractual excuses, which are also considered as an exception to the principle of the necessity of contracts, have been identified under different titles and chapters in international and regional instruments, and the effects and remedies of that will also differ on the contract. In this article, while emphasizing the difference between contractual excuses from the “stabilization clause” which is used in Oil and Gas contracts, by examining the practical procedure of arranging and inserting the excuses clauses in several examples of these contracts, the authors at first try to introduce the types of terms and after pointing out the defects of each one, they have mentioned the necessary cases of amending and changing these contracts in order to comply with international and regional instruments.
